반응형

1. Oracle Client 를 설치 및 TNS 설정(tnsnames.ora)

2. SSMS에서 서버개체>연결된 서버 마우스 오른쪽 버튼> 새 연결된 서버 ... 선택

3. 일반 에서 공급자는 Oracle Provider for OLE DB를 선택, 제품이름 및 데이터원본에는 TNS 명 입력


4. 보안에서 '다음 보안 컨텍스트를 사용하여 연결' 선택 후 ID, PW 입력 후 확인



5. SSMS 에서 서버 개체>연결된 서버>공급자>OraOLEDB.Oracle 속성에서 Inprocess 허용을 check 해 준다.

반응형
반응형

SQL서버 2008 SSMS 로그인할 때 암호저장을 체크 해 놓아도 저장이 안되는 경우가 있다.

보안상 좋을지는 몰라도 매번 입력하기가 여간 성가시지 않다.

이때는 다음 파일을 찾아서 삭제 하면 된다.

단 기존에 저장되어 있던 목록이 모두 삭제 되는 문제는 있지만 어차피 자주 로그인 하는 경우라면

한번만 다시 입력하면 되므로, 매번 암호입력을 해야 되는 수고를 덜 수 있다면 그정도는 감수 할 만.

Windows 7 의 경우 : C:\Users\사용자\AppData\Roaming\Microsoft\Microsoft SQL Server\100\Tools\Shell\SqlStudio.bin

Windows XP의 경우 : C:\Documents and Settings\사용자\Application Data\Microsoft\Microsoft SQL Server\100\Tools\Shell\SqlStudio.bin

해당 파일을 삭제 한 다음 반드시 SSMS 를 재시작 해야만 효과를 볼 수 있다. 
반응형

+ Recent posts